a sorba is a very basic turkish wood/coal burning stove
we bought ours in ortaca for 180 lire which included all chimney fitttings (it is a simtas make which apparently is supposed to be one of the best)you can buy them anywhere, the world and his wife sell them.

Carbon monoxide is colourless,and odourless and deadly,i.e.,it kills people in their sleep.It is produced by burning all hydrocarbons,wood,coal etc.Bought a digital one in UK for out here,and not just for when the soba is up and running,but we also have a gas cooker and fire.As important to have in any house as smoke alarms.I was a firefighter for 23 years and saw the importance of both in that time.
